Presentation Convent is a serene church located in San Antonio TX known for its welcoming atmosphere and beautiful architecture. This spiritual haven offers a peaceful space for worship reflection and community gatherings. With its rich history and commitment to service Presentation Convent serves as a vital part of the local Catholic community.
Generated from this place's information